  The Fuel-Easy helicopter fuel tank system, designed by SEI Industries Ltd., is designed for aerial transport to and from forest fires in the safest, fastest mode of transportation possible. The aerodynamic design of the Fuel-easy(tm) helicopter fuel tank allows for aerial transport via helicopter in maximum cruise speed. Fuel-Easy offers the operator greatly increased fuel-hauling capability compared to the fuel drum.

The shell of the helicopter fuel tank is made of radio frequency welded polyester or nylon scrim coated fabric. Fuel-Easys body is cradled by vertical straps to create points for a lifting harness. Its five minute set-up allows for a fully usable product to be filled and in the air in less time. Pliable, puncture safe material allows for full collapse when not in use. When collapsed, the unit can be hand carried in a pair of bags. This external fluid container is safe as well as cost efficient. Fuel-Easy offers the operator greatly increased fuel-hauling capability compared to the fuel drum with the added convenience of knowing clean fluids will stay clean and contaminant free until needed.

Camlock fittings are used on both top and bottom of the helicopter fuel tank. The bottom camlock fitting allows for gravity draining. No vapor, less waste provides portable fluid for forest fire suppression work as well as ferrying operations. The system is available in three sizes. Large units use a galvanized steel frame, or slightly smaller units using a cast aluminum frame.

This helicopter fuel tank has been tested in the most rugged conditions. Predictable and stable in flight, the Fuel-Easy system has been tested from the Arctic to African deserts. This aerial transportation system has performed equally well under any conditions. This translates into safe delivery of fluid each and every time.

Optional Features

Optional ground hoses, optional fittings, separate ground wire to connect the bladder with the stand of the helicopter fuel tank.

Safety Features

The Fuel Easy helicopter fuel tank has a rigid frame that maintains its configuration in any condition. A partial load will allow the frame to collapse into itself to allow for full stabilization while in flight.

  Flexitank is a product that has become very popular to store and transport all kinds of liquids and chemicals. This is something you can place on a 20 feet dry contained and it can easily be applied and it allows the full use of the container space. With flexitank you can easily transport all kinds of liquids like latex, wine, lubricants, additives, edible oils and many more.

Flexitank can be considered to be extremely safe as it is made of very strong and flexible multi layer polyethylene inner liners, it is encapsulated by a strong one side coated fabric out liner and it has some unique mechanical properties which allow the liquids to survive any kind of stress that they may have to face during transportation.

Flexitank can also be considered to be very reliable as it is made from virgin resin and it follows all the standards required when you are transporting any kind of edible and food products in liquid form. It follows the quality control procedures and extensive testing to assure full quality and it can easily be disposed without causing any kind of environmental issues as well.

Flexitank can be used to transport all kind of liquids and they include concentrate fruit juices, wine, vegetable oils, mineral water, glucose and malt extracts and also you can transport other products like base oils, lubricants, transformer oils, fertilizers and additives as well.

The usage of flexitank can be very important when you are in the middle of a natural or manmade emergency where you need to transport liquids to areas where there is a deficiency of food and other raw materials as well.

Installation and usage of flexitank is extremely simple. The tanks comes folded in cardboard boxes which can be packed up in palette and which can be easily transported to the place where they need to be utilized.

Flexitanks have been manufactured keeping all the facilities in mind which include whether you want to have a top charge and discharge system or whether you want to have a bottom discharge system depending on the kind of liquid and the way how you want to install the flexitank on your container.

You do not need to have any kind of special training to be able to handle and install the flexitank and therefore, this can prove to be a very important equipment where emergencies are always asking for the best and the fastest and easiest methods of transportation of equipment and materials.
